--- mcore-src/trunk/mcore-tools/daemon/client/include/input.client.class 2013/05/08 12:40:39 2060 +++ mcore-src/trunk/mcore-tools/daemon/client/include/input.client.class 2013/09/27 07:50:45 2097 @@ -63,7 +63,7 @@ set_input_keymap() { local value="$1" - local CONFIG="${MROOT}/etc/X11/xorg.conf.d/00-keyboard.conf" + local CONFIG [[ -z ${value} ]] && help_input_keymap && return 1 @@ -75,6 +75,13 @@ # x11 keymaps localectl set-x11-keymap "${value}" else + CONFIG="${MROOT}/etc/vconsole.conf" + clearconfig + addconfig "KEYMAP=\"${value}\"" + addconfig 'FONT="lat9w-16"' + addconfig 'FONT_MAP="8851-1_to_uni"' + + CONFIG="${MROOT}/etc/X11/xorg.conf.d/00-keyboard.conf" clearconfig addconfig 'Section "InputClass"' addconfig ' Identifier "keyboard layout"'